Home Previous Up Next Index

armarx::NJointBimanualCartesianAdmittanceControllerInterface

Overview

interface NJointBimanualCartesianAdmittanceControllerInterface extends NJointControllerInterface

Operation Index

setConfig
setDesiredJointValuesLeft
setDesiredJointValuesRight
setNullspaceConfig
setAdmittanceConfig
setForceConfig
setImpedanceConfig
getBoxPose
setBoxPose
setBoxWidth
setBoxVelocity
setBoxPoseAndVelocity
moveBoxPose
moveBoxPosition

Operations

void setConfig(NJointBimanualCartesianAdmittanceControllerConfig cfg)

void setDesiredJointValuesLeft(::Ice::FloatSeq cfg)

void setDesiredJointValuesRight(::Ice::FloatSeq cfg)

void setNullspaceConfig(detail::NJBmanCartAdmCtrl::Nullspace nullspace)

void setAdmittanceConfig(detail::NJBmanCartAdmCtrl::Admittance admittanceObject)

void setForceConfig(detail::NJBmanCartAdmCtrl::Force left, detail::NJBmanCartAdmCtrl::Force right)

void setImpedanceConfig(detail::NJBmanCartAdmCtrl::Impedance left, detail::NJBmanCartAdmCtrl::Impedance right)

::Eigen::Matrix4f getBoxPose()

void setBoxPose(::Eigen::Matrix4f pose)

void setBoxWidth(float w)

void setBoxVelocity(::Eigen::Vector3f velXYZ, ::Eigen::Vector3f velRPY)

void setBoxPoseAndVelocity(::Eigen::Matrix4f pose, ::Eigen::Vector3f velXYZ, ::Eigen::Vector3f velRPY)

void moveBoxPose(::Eigen::Matrix4f pose)

void moveBoxPosition(::Eigen::Vector3f pos)


Home Previous Up Next Index